Licensing and Regulation: The French Way
Unlike some jurisdictions where regulation is as loose as a gambler’s wallet after a bad streak, France takes its gaming laws seriously. The Autorité Nationale des Jeux (ANJ) oversees the market, ensuring operators play by the rules. This means any site operating legally must hold a French license, which is no small feat.
However, the presence of a license doesn’t guarantee a smooth ride. Some platforms comply with the letter of the law but might still leave players feeling like they’ve been dealt a cold deck. It’s a reminder that regulation is just one piece of the puzzle.
Payment Methods: More Than Just a Quick Deposit
Trying to fund your account or cash out winnings can sometimes feel like trying to hit a royal flush with a pair of twos. French players often face limited payment options compared to other markets, with credit cards, e-wallets, and bank transfers being the usual suspects.
- Credit/Debit Cards: Visa and Mastercard dominate, but watch out for processing fees.
- E-Wallets: PayPal and Skrill offer convenience but aren’t universally accepted.
- Bank Transfers: Reliable but slower, especially for withdrawals.
- Prepaid Cards: A decent option for those wary of sharing bank details.
Choosing the right payment method can be as critical as picking the right game. After all, what’s the point of winning if you can’t get your hands on the cash?

Bonuses and Promotions: The Fine Print Edition
Here’s where the irony kicks in. Bonuses often look like a sweet deal until you read the fine print, which can be as dense as a blackjack dealer’s stare. Wagering requirements, game restrictions, and time limits can turn a seemingly generous offer into a wild goose chase.
French players should approach bonuses with a healthy dose of skepticism. Sometimes, the best “bonus” is simply a fair and transparent platform that doesn’t try to bamboozle you with convoluted terms.
